#ifndef APE_SMARTPTR_H
|
||
|
#define APE_SMARTPTR_H
|
||
|
|
||
|
// disable the operator -> on UDT warning
|
||
|
#ifdef _WIN32
|
||
|
# pragma warning( push )
|
||
|
# pragma warning( disable : 4284 )
|
||
|
#endif
|
||
|
|
||
|
/*************************************************************************************************
|
||
|
CSmartPtr - a simple smart pointer class that can automatically initialize and free memory
|
||
|
note: (doesn't do garbage collection / reference counting because of the many pitfalls)
|
||
|
*************************************************************************************************/
|
||
|
template <class TYPE> class CSmartPtr
|
||
|
{
|
||
|
public:
|
||
|
TYPE * m_pObject;
|
||
|
BOOL m_bArray;
|
||
|
BOOL m_bDelete;
|
||
|
|
||
|
CSmartPtr()
|
||
|
{
|
||
|
m_bDelete = TRUE;
|
||
|
m_pObject = NULL;
|
||
|
}
|
||
|
CSmartPtr(TYPE * a_pObject, BOOL a_bArray = FALSE, BOOL a_bDelete = TRUE)
|
||
|
{
|
||
|
m_bDelete = TRUE;
|
||
|
m_pObject = NULL;
|
||
|
Assign(a_pObject, a_bArray, a_bDelete);
|
||
|
}
|
||
|
|
||
|
~CSmartPtr()
|
||
|
{
|
||
|
Delete();
|
||
|
}
|
||
|
|
||
|
void Assign(TYPE * a_pObject, BOOL a_bArray = FALSE, BOOL a_bDelete = TRUE)
|
||
|
{
|
||
|
Delete();
|
||
|
|
||
|
m_bDelete = a_bDelete;
|
||
|
m_bArray = a_bArray;
|
||
|
m_pObject = a_pObject;
|
||
|
}
|
||
|
|
||
|
void Delete()
|
||
|
{
|
||
|
if (m_bDelete && m_pObject)
|
||
|
{
|
||
|
if (m_bArray)
|
||
|
delete [] m_pObject;
|
||
|
else
|
||
|
delete m_pObject;
|
||
|
|
||
|
m_pObject = NULL;
|
||
|
}
|
||
|
}
|
||
|
|
||
|
void SetDelete(const BOOL a_bDelete)
|
||
|
{
|
||
|
m_bDelete = a_bDelete;
|
||
|
}
|
||
|
|
||
|
__inline TYPE * GetPtr() const
|
||
|
{
|
||
|
return m_pObject;
|
||
|
}
|
||
|
|
||
|
__inline operator TYPE * () const
|
||
|
{
|
||
|
return m_pObject;
|
||
|
}
|
||
|
|
||
|
__inline TYPE * operator ->() const
|
||
|
{
|
||
|
return m_pObject;
|
||
|
}
|
||
|
|
||
|
// declare assignment, but don't implement (compiler error if we try to use)
|
||
|
// that way we can't carelessly mix smart pointers and regular pointers
|
||
|
__inline void * operator =(void *) const;
|
||
|
};
|
||
|
|
||
|
#ifdef _WIN32
|
||
|
# pragma warning( pop )
|
||
|
#endif
|
||
|
|
||
|
#endif /* APE_SMARTPTR_H */
